1. java
  2. android
  3. c#
  4. .net
  5. javascript
  6. php
  7. jquery
  8. html
  9. sql

Conexão offline com java web start

Tenho uma dúvida quando a Java Web Start. O JWS já está funcionando quando a rede está normal. O problema ocorre quando o desktop fica sem rede. Pois, ao executar a aplicação que baixei anteriormente retorna que usuário e/ou senha é inválido. E se executo pelo /dist mesmo que sem conexão funciona normalmente (com mesmo usuário e senha). Acredito que possa ser alguma configuração trocada. Alguém sabe me dizer o que pode estar causando isto? (Obs.: a baixo está o arquivo JNLP)

 <?xml version="1.0" encoding="UTF-8" standalone="no"?>
  <jnlp codebase="http://atualiza.XXXX.XXXX.br:8777/XXXX/" href="launch.jnlp" spec="1.0+">
      <information>
          <title>XXXX</title>
          <vendor>XXXX XXXX XXXX</vendor>
          <homepage href=""/>
          <description>Terceira versão do XXXX.</description>
          <description kind="short">XXXX</description>
          <shortcut install="false" online="true">
              <desktop/>
              <menu submenu="XXXX"/>
          </shortcut>
      <icon href="sistema_principal.png" kind="default"/>
  <offline-allowed/>
  </information>
      <!--<update check="always" policy="prompt-update"></update>-->
      <security>
  <all-permissions/>
  </security>
      <resources>
          <j2se java-vm-args="-Xms512m -Xmx800m -Duser.timezone=GMT-3" version="1.7+"/>
          <jar href="XXXX.jar" main="true"/>
      <jar href="lib/JDA.jar"/>
  <jar href="lib/postgresql-9.2-1002.jdbc4.jar"/>
  <jar href="lib/AbsoluteLayout.jar"/>
  <jar href="lib/JXXXXDataTexto.jar"/>
  <jar href="lib/commons-beanutils-1.8.0.jar"/>
  <jar href="lib/commons-collections-3.2.1.jar"/>
  <jar href="lib/commons-digester-1.7.jar"/>
  <jar href="lib/commons-javaflow-20060411.jar"/>
  <jar href="lib/commons-logging-1.1.jar"/>
  <jar href="lib/firebirdsql-full.jar"/>
  <jar href="lib/hamcrest-core-1.3.jar"/>
  <jar href="lib/iText-2.1.0.jar"/>
  <jar href="lib/jasperreports-3.7.1.jar"/>
  <jar href="lib/jcalendar-1.3.3.jar"/>
  <jar href="lib/jcommon-1.0.23.jar"/>
  <jar href="lib/jfreechart-1.0.19-experimental.jar"/>
  <jar href="lib/jfreechart-1.0.19-swt.jar"/>
  <jar href="lib/jfreechart-1.0.19.jar"/>
  <jar href="lib/jfreesvg-2.0.jar"/>
  <jar href="lib/junit-4.11.jar"/>
  <jar href="lib/jxl.jar"/>
  <jar href="lib/log4j-1.2.9.jar"/>
  <jar href="lib/looks-2.0.1.jar"/>
  <jar href="lib/ojdbc5.jar"/>
  <jar href="lib/orsoncharts-1.4-eval-nofx.jar"/>
  <jar href="lib/orsonpdf-1.6-eval.jar"/>
  <jar href="lib/servlet.jar"/>
  <jar href="lib/swtgraphics2d.jar"/>
  <jar href="lib/toplink-essentials.jar"/>
  <extension href="jnlpcomponent2.jnlp"/>
  <extension href="jnlpcomponent1.jnlp"/>
  </resources>
      <application-desc main-class="com.XXXX.modulos.WindowXXXX">
      </application-desc>
  </jnlp>

Percebi que quando conecta corretamente no banco de dados (modo online), são exibidas as linhas abaixo: [TopLink Info]: 2015.05.22 08:54:40.295--ServerSession(8052910)--TopLink, version: Oracle TopLink Essentials - 2.0.1 (Build b09d-fcs (12/06/2007)) [TopLink Info]: 2015.05.22 08:54:45.100--ServerSession(8052910)--http://atualiza.XXXX.XXXX.br:XXXX/teste/XXXX.jar-XXXXPU login

Na segunda linha, pode-se observar que o persistence-unit do top link está utilizando http://atualiza.XXXX.XXXX.br:XXXX/teste/XXXX.jar, que é onde está meu projeto no servidor apache tomcat. Isso pode ter alguma relação com o erro no modo offline?

  • Alguém? Alguém pode me ajudar?

    Vlads Barcelos   25 de mai de 2015
  1. Você vai ver essas setas em qualquer página de pergunta. Com elas, você pode dizer se uma pergunta ou uma resposta foram relevantes ou não.
  2. Edite sua pergunta ou resposta caso queira alterar ou adicionar detalhes.
  3. Caso haja alguma dúvida sobre a pergunta, adicione um comentário. O espaço de respostas deve ser utilizado apenas para responder a pergunta.
  4. Se o autor da pergunta marcar uma resposta como solucionada, esta marca aparecerá.
  5. Clique aqui para mais detalhes sobre o funcionamento do GUJ!

0 resposta

Não é a resposta que estava procurando? Procure outras perguntas com as tags java ou faça a sua própria pergunta.